Single Epithet and its justification in Letters of the Nahj al-Balagha

Abstract:
Single epithet is a type of epithets which follows its own description in case of the expression, ‘known’ and ‘unknown’, gender, and number. It is used for different ‘purposes’ including ‘allocation’, ‘clarification’, praise, admiration, blame and criticism, emphasis, ambiguity, ‘detail’, ‘extension’, and pity. This research investigates the single epithet along with its purposes and justifications in the letters of Amir al-Mu’minin Ali (pbuh) in the Nahj al-Balagha, using the descriptive analysis method. The findings of the research show that the two justifications of ‘allocation’ (i.e. the restriction of shared circle of the ‘unknown’) and ‘clarification’ (i.e. the removal of the ‘known’ possibilities) have high frequency in the letters of the Nahj al-Balagha. Also the ‘purpose’ of praise and admiration is first addressed to God Almighty. After the essence of Almighty, it is addressed to the Holy Prophet, the Family of Prophet, and the Righteous, respectively. Moreover, the adjectives of blame and criticism are addressed to Satan and ‘Passion’ and the ‘purposes’ of emphasis and ambiguity are seen in the Imam’s speech with less function.
